has glosseng: Mírzá `Alí-Muḥammad-i-Khurásání (d.1928) known as Ibn-i-Aṣdaq , was an eminent follower of Baháulláh, the founder of the Baháí Faith, a global religion of Persian origin. He was appointed a Hand of the Cause, and identified as one of the nineteen Apostles of Baháu'lláh.
